Sales quota 100% for Cornet Obolensky youngster auction

After a successful first edition last year, the Westfälisches Pferdestammbuch organised the second online auction in cooperation with the Zhashkiv Stud in the Ukraine when 32 youngsters bred at this studfarm were offered for sale.  They are all closely related to the star sire Cornet Obolensky, who is also based in the Ukraine.

The 20 stallions and 12 mares aroused great interest among international customers, and with a total turnover of €440,500, all the two-and-a-half-year-olds on offer were successfully sold. On average, customers invested €13,766 in their future showjumping prospects, and around one-third of the horses were knocked down for more than €15,000.

Customers outside of Germany showed great interest in the auction collection, with 75% of the horses going to 12 different countries. This youngster collection was especially well received by customers in the east, with six youngsters remaining in the Ukraine, while four will travel to Iran and three to Uzbekistan.

The Cornet Obolensky daughter Cathleen created the most enthusiasm.  Her dam, Verb.Pr.St. Diamond (Diarado), is the half-sister to Conthargos, and 15 parties bid for this grey mare. Finally, at the 39th bid, the virtual hammer fell in favour of German clients at €26,000.

Among the 20 stallions, head number one, Abercrombie, also attracted the highest price. jThe son of Air Jordan x Cornet Obolensky descends from Holstein line 1333, which has already produced several successful showjumpers. The grey stallion sold for €24,000 to customers from Russia.
